NYC is gearing up to launch the first ever Community Health Worker apprenticeship with a special focus on Behavioral Health. Apprentices will complete credit-bearing classes with CUNY and gain on-the-job training with non-profits providing health and mental health services. To become an employer partner and hire apprentices for the 2025 cycle, join an info session on Nov 19th or Dec 3rd. This is an excellent opportunity for New York City organizations interested in hiring or expanding their staff to include community health workers and similar positions (community advocates, community educators, outreach workers, and others) in behavioral health settings or other community settings. Info sessions will highlight the unique benefits of Registered Apprenticeships Programs, including available funding opportunities, how to get started, and the ROI for participating organizations.
